Abstract
Mechatronic design optimization is a complex process
characterized by an important number of requirements,
design variables, constraints and objectives. Therefore, it is very
important to decompose efficiently the system design problem
into a set of sub-problems to minimize the computational cost
while profiting from the spatial distribution of design tools,
working teams and expertise. However, coordinating design
optimization of a distributed design is a real issue to overcome.
In this study, a new efficient collaborative optimization approach
based on multi-agent paradigm is proposed for mechatronic
design optimization. The proposed method is applied to the
preliminary design case of an electric vehicle to demonstrate
its validity and effectiveness.
